Apartments nearby Foncquevillers

1 found

La Grange

Set in Foncquevillers, La Grange offers accommodation with a balcony and free WiFi. The apartment features garden views and is 43 km from Lens.

More Apartments in other Cities

Interesting places in Foncquevillers

Search this area
MAPS.ME
is always on hand
Download the apps and start expanding your horizons
Open Maps.me app
Use web version